Dear Swiss-list members:

EuroCircle San Francisco is proud to join forces with the Bubble Lounge in
organizing a fundraising event this Thursday, September 27th, 2001. Hereby, we
are following our other chapters in raising funds for the September 11th
tragedy. Kaisa Kokkonen, the founder of EuroCircle, will be joining us from New
York.
 
It is a difficult time, as all of us have been affected by the events of the
last week in one or the other way. EuroCircle New York received hundreds of
messages from our members in Europe and the United States expressing their
sadness, sympathy and solidarity with New Yorkers. In some messages from
Europe, people were asking for our assistance in contacting their loved ones in
New York. Not always were we able to provide good news, because many people
are still missing. Some of the EuroCircle members have been participating in
the search and recovery mission at the site of the attack. Others have
volunteered their expertise where needed. Many members donated blood, supplies
and money.

The Bubble Lounge New York has been deeply affected as well, being located just
a few blocks from where the World Trade Center once proudly stood. Many of its
customers were men and women working at the Towers who would come to The Bubble
Lounge to relax and enjoy a drink with colleagues, friends or family. In six
years, these familiar faces became more than just "regulars" --they became
friends.
